How to Store an Open Bottle of Red Wine: Refrigeration & More

WebJan 5, 2024 · The ideal storage temperature for red wine is about 55° F but the normal temperature inside a kitchen refrigerator is around 35-40° F. This means refrigerators are too cold for long-term storage of red wines. Prolonged exposure to these cooler temperatures can cause your wine to degrade over time.
